Regular Season Round 17: Chiba Jets - Osaka Evessa 67-77
Date: December 2, 2011
No shocking result in a game when first ranked Osaka Evessa (12-4) beat on the road 4th placed Chiba Jets (9-7) 77-67 on Friday. The guests trailed by 2 points after first quarter, but they rallied back to get the 1-point lead at the halftime and eventually won the game 77-67. Osaka Evessa dominated down low during the game scoring 52 of its points in the paint compared to Chiba Jets' 28. They outrebounded Chiba Jets 50-31 including a 40-26 advantage in defensive rebounds. American players dominated also this game. Forward Lawrence Blackledge (206-86, college: Marquette) orchestrated the victory with a double-double by scoring 16 points, 20 rebounds and 5 assists. Center Wayne Marshall (211-86, college: Temple) contributed with a double-double by scoring 20 points and 12 rebounds for the winners. Blackledge is a former Eurobasket Summer League player, which is considered top summer league for players who want to play basketball overseas. Guard Maurice Hargrow (193-83, college: Minnesota) answered with 14 points and 7 assists and guard Jamel Staten (198-83, college: Minnesota St.) added 14 points and 6 rebounds in the effort for Chiba Jets. Both teams had four players each who scored in double figures. Osaka Evessa maintains first place with 12-4 record. Loser Chiba Jets dropped to the third position with seven games lost. Both teams do not play next round, which will be an opportunity for some rest.
